Jersey's Chief Minister told the States today that the Waterfront fiasco has left him wrongly portrayed as either 'an idiot' or 'a liar'.

He's accused of either being duped by the Waterfront Enterprise Board and the developers, or deliberately misleading the House.

Senator Frank Walker says he's never known such a bitter and acrimonious dispute during his 18 years in the States.

There's a vote of censure against the Bailiff. The Council of Ministers face a vote of no confidence. And Senator Walker himself also faces a vote of censure.

It comes to a head on July 1st. Senator Walker has promised a full investigation and says all the reports will be made public before the debate.
